What to Expect from the Turtle Snorkeling Tour

This tour promises a straightforward, intimate journey into the waters off Akumal, starting from a well-known meeting point near Playa del Carmen. You’ll begin your adventure by meeting at a convenient spot, 7-Eleven Akumal, and then get suited up with all the snorkeling gear needed—mask, new snorkel tube, and a life jacket.
Once ready, you’ll wade into the water about 25 meters from the shore, where the protected areas start. This start point is crucial because it signifies where the marine life, especially the turtles, are more likely to be found in their undisturbed environment. The tour lasts roughly an hour, a decent window for observing marine creatures without feeling rushed.
The Marine Environment
The area features parts of a coral reef, along with a variety of fish, rays, and other marine creatures that add to the snorkeling spectacle. Many participants report that the main highlight is definitely seeing sea turtles in their natural habitat, which is increasingly rare in touristy areas. Being in a protected zone not only enhances your chances of spotting turtles but also ensures that the environment remains relatively undisturbed, making your experience more meaningful.
Equipment and Inclusions
The tour fee covers all the gear you need—a mask, snorkel, and life jacket—so you don’t have to worry about renting or bringing your own. The admission fee is included, which simplifies the process. If you do decide to drive, note that parking costs MX$100 per booking, so factor that into your budget.

FAQ

Is this tour suitable for children?
Since the tour involves snorkeling, most travelers who are comfortable in the water can join. It’s not specifically marketed as family-friendly, but if children are confident swimmers, they should be fine.
What is included in the price?
The fee covers all snorkeling equipment—mask, new snorkel tube, and a life jacket—as well as the admission fee to the protected area.
How long is the tour?
The activity lasts approximately 1 hour, starting from the meeting point and ending back there.
Do I need to bring my own gear?
No, all necessary equipment is provided as part of the tour price.
Where does the tour start and end?
It begins at 7-Eleven Akumal and finishes back at the same meeting point.
What if the weather is bad?
Good weather is necessary for the tour to run smoothly. If canceled due to poor conditions, you’ll be offered a different date or a full refund if you cancel more than 24 hours in advance.
How much does parking cost?
If you drive, parking costs MX$100 per booking, so plan accordingly.
